[CentOS-devel] [opstools] How to support fluentd with ruby24?

Wed Dec 13 18:36:34 UTC 2017
Rich Megginson <rmeggins at redhat.com>

We need to use the ruby24 SCL.

That means ovirt and rdo will have a dependency on ruby24 SCL, which 
also means the fluentd systemd service will need to know how to run the 
service using the scl, unless ovirt and rdo are ready to run fluentd 
containerized, in which case it is as simple as using the centos ruby24 
scl base image, which is what openshift is doing: 
https://github.com/openshift/origin-aggregated-logging/blob/master/fluentd/Dockerfile.centos7#L1

ruby24 will be needed at build time for some packages as well as at runtime.

https://www.centos.org/minutes/2017/December/centos-devel.2017-12-13-18.04.log.html